Shillelaghs are traditionally made from blackthorn, but being from the barren tundra of southern Minnesota, blackthorn is not that readily available here; so I'm going to use some Black Cherry (Prunus serotina) branches that I have.

It's going to be some time till they're ready, the branches need to be completely dried out to work with them, a common method to cure shillelaghs is smeared them with grease and put up in a chimney to be smoked, giving the Shillelagh its typical black shiny appearance. But, this can cause them to develop cracks and break. Instead I'm going to let them dry out slowly on their own, which ideally takes a few years.
